More so out of curiosity than anything....does anyone know the conditions that affect the dots on the regen/power bar?

Obviously it’s very much temperature dependant but the limitation of regen and power varies so much.....some days I have full power but the regen side is dotted to half way.
On other occasions I have full regen but the power side is restricted. Any ideas what influences this behaviour?
 
I had dotted power but full regen this year, but don’t remember having it last year. SoC was about 40% I think too, definitely not 20% anyway.

precondition the battery (turn on climate remotely while it’s unoccupied and don’t open any doors) for ~20 mins to greatly reduce the regen degradation.

Do it while still plugged into power, but NOT charging, to reduce the net battery power usage for it (it uses ~13kW at peak ). If you’re charging at the same time it will prioritise charging and won’t precondition (as much?)

I’m not sure that that’s accurate.
When my car is charging and saying, for instance, 2 hours to go, if I turn on climate it will eventually say that it’s got 24+ hours to go.
This suggests that it will prioritise the preconditioning when you turn it on whilst charging.
